Understanding Rebar Mesh
Rebar mesh, also known as welded wire fabric, consists of a network of steel bars or wires that are welded together at regular intervals to form a grid. This configuration enhances the tensile strength of concrete, which is naturally strong in compression but weak in tension. As construction engineer Sarah Thompson notes, “Rebar mesh is essential in providing the needed support to prevent cracking in concrete under tension.” This inherent strength makes rebar mesh indispensable in a variety of projects.
The Versatile Uses of Rebar Mesh
Rebar mesh finds its utility in numerous applications across multiple sectors. Here’s a breakdown of some of its significant uses, backed by expert opinions:
1. Reinforcement in Concrete Slabs
One of the primary applications of rebar mesh is in the reinforcement of concrete slabs. Civil engineer Tom Richards emphasizes, “By placing rebar mesh within concrete slabs, we not only enhance their capacity to bear loads but also improve durability against environmental factors.” This is particularly important in constructing commercial buildings, parking lots, and driveways, where structural integrity is crucial.
2. Construction of Roads and Highways
In the realm of road construction, rebar mesh plays a critical role in ensuring longevity and safety. Transportation planner Lisa Chen states, “In roadways, rebar mesh helps distribute load and resist cracking, leading to longer-lasting pavements.” Its incorporation in roadways can significantly reduce maintenance costs and enhance the overall lifespan of the infrastructure.
3. Foundations and Footings
When it comes to foundations, the role of rebar mesh can’t be overlooked. Structural engineer Mark Wilson highlights that “using rebar mesh in footings and foundations helps to create a solid base for any structure.” It acts as a stabilizing factor, allowing for better performance during natural events such as earthquakes or heavy winds.
4. Retaining Walls and Other Vertical Structures
Retaining walls are another critical application for rebar mesh. Landscape architect Jennifer Lopez explains, “Rebar mesh ensures that retaining walls can withstand lateral pressures from earth and water, providing essential support to prevent collapse.” Its use in such structures is vital for both safety and aesthetic appeal.
